Warrick 26C1D1F LWCO
The Warrick 26C1D1F is a heavy-duty 120V low water cut-off (LWCO) liquid level control designed for boiler feed and burner protection applications. As a conductivity-based level switch, it utilizes the Series 26 controller platform, featuring a normally closed (NC) contact configuration and an integrated reset push button. This unit is housed in a robust NEMA 1 enclosure, ensuring reliable performance in commercial and industrial settings. The 26C1D1F functions as a direct field replacement for legacy models including the 26C1A1F, 26C1C1F, and 26C1D0F, allowing for seamless integration into existing Warrick liquid level control systems without extensive rewiring. Engineered for high-sensitivity detection, this controller maintains precise signal integrity even in high-temperature environments, providing a critical safety layer for steam boilers and hydronic systems. Its solid-state design eliminates moving parts, significantly reducing downtime and ensuring consistent boiler safety control operation.

How do I wire the Warrick 26C1D1F for a burner circuit?
The unit features NC (Normally Closed) contacts that open upon sensing a low water condition. Ensure the burner circuit is wired in series with the control contacts to provide an immediate safety shutdown.
Can the sensitivity be adjusted for different water types?
Yes, the Series 26 controller is factory-calibrated for standard conductivity levels but can be field-tuned if dealing with high-purity water or specific chemical additives that affect electrical resistance.
What is the primary difference between this and the 26C1D0F?
The 26C1D1F includes a manual reset push button and a NEMA 1 enclosure, whereas the D0F variant typically lacks the reset feature required by many current boiler safety codes.
